Data Center Industry Challenges

With soaring heat densities from AI and hyperscale workloads, operators face extreme pressure to slash PUE (Power Usage Effectiveness) and WUE (Water Usage Effectiveness). Traditional open cooling towers consume enormous amounts of water, risking environmental rejection in water-scarce zones. Additionally, airborne contaminants in open loops cause scaling and clogging in plate heat exchangers or server-side microchannels, leading to fatal localized overheating.


CRONX (formerly CASEN) Dedicated Equipment & Solutions

CRONX (formerly CASEN) deploys advanced Closed Circuit Cooling Towers to isolate the critical data center loop (pure water or glycol solution) entirely inside heavy-duty, seamless coil bundles. To conquer the high-OpEx challenge, the integrated smart control system runs in pure air-cooled Dry Mode during winter to bring water consumption to absolute zero, while leveraging evaporative latent heat in Wet/Hybrid Modes during peak summer, dramatically shaving down the PUE metric.

A large industrial park located in a tropical coastal region of the Philippines required a reliable circulating water cooling solution for multiple manufacturing facilities. The cooling system serves both central air-conditioning systems and process cooling equipment. Due to the region’s high temperatures, humidity, and salt-laden coastal air, the customer required a corrosion-resistant, low-maintenance solution capable of delivering stable performance year-round.
